Neighborhoods to consider for Manhattan vacation rentals

Each Manhattan neighborhood has a distinct vibe, dining scene, and rhythm. Use these snapshots to guide your Unit / Apartment Unit / Apartment Accommodation choice and to tailor your activities around where you stay.

  • Midtown and Times Square — the epicenter of Broadway, neon-lit nights, and easy access to transport hubs. Ideal for first-time visitors who want iconic sights within a short walk. Look for vacation rentals with floor-to-ceiling windows that frame the city’s frenetic skyline and quick commutes to theater districts and major attractions.
  • Upper West Side — a more residential, family-friendly feel with tree-lined streets, the American Museum of Natural History, Central Park’s western edge, and classic brownstones. A great choice for travelers seeking a quieter base while staying close to top museums and cafes.
  • Upper East Side — refined, elegant, and museum-rich, with elegant townhouses and upscale dining. Apartment accommodations here tend to be spacious and polished, perfect for travelers who appreciate a more relaxed, upscale vibe after a day of city exploration.
  • Chelsea and the Flatiron District — art galleries, chic eateries, the High Line, and accessibility to Chelsea Market. This area blends trendy energy with comfortable residential options, making it a favorite for couples and small groups.
  • SoHo and Tribeca — fashion-forward, with cobblestone streets, boutique shopping, and a thriving restaurant scene. Expect stylish apartment units, loft layouts, and easy access to nightlife, galleries, and iconic architecture.
  • Harlem — rich in music history, soul food, and a vibrant culture scene. Staying here offers affordable vacation rental options with authentic experiences, live music venues, and a sense of community that’s hard to match in a bigger tourist corridor.
  • Lower Manhattan and Battery Park City — water views, financial district bustle, and easy access to the ferry to Ellis Island and the Statue of Liberty. Great for travelers who want to be close to riverfront parks, monument sites, and newer apartment developments.

Practical tips for selecting and booking a Manhattan vacation rental

To maximize value and reduce travel friction, consider these practical pointers when choosing your search and stay plan.

  • Proximity to transit — Manhattan’s subway network is the fastest way to hop between neighborhoods. If you’ll be hopping to museums, shows, and family activities, choose a unit near a subway line or a major bus route.
  • Sound and light — Manhattan stays can be busy. Look for listings with soundproofing or higher floors if you’re near lively streets. Blackout curtains help with restful mornings or late nights after shows.
  • Kitchen and laundry — a full kitchen and in-unit laundry add convenience, especially for longer stays or families traveling with kids.
  • Elevator access — if you’re traveling with a lot of luggage or younger kids, confirm elevator access in multi-story buildings to avoid stair-heavy climbs.
  • Guest policies and flexible dates — some Manhattan units have strict check-in/out times or guest caps. Look for listings that clearly outline policies and offer flexible date options when possible.
  • Reviews and host communication — current guest feedback is a strong signal for cleanliness, safety, and accuracy. A responsive host makes a huge difference in a busy city stay.
